What is the difference between Live In Construction Project Manager vs Construction Supervisor?

AspectLive In Construction Project ManagerConstruction Supervisor
CredentialsRelevant certifications (e.g., PMP), experience in project managementTrade certifications, experience in site supervision
Work EnvironmentOversees entire project, often on-site, with living arrangements providedOn-site supervision of daily activities, may or may not live on-site
Employer & Industry UsageConstruction firms managing large projects, especially remote sitesConstruction companies overseeing daily site operations

The main difference is that a Live In Construction Project Manager oversees entire projects and often resides on-site, focusing on planning, coordination, and management. In contrast, a Construction Supervisor handles daily site activities and may or may not live on-site. Both roles require relevant experience, but the Project Manager typically has broader responsibilities and credentials.

How much does a live in construction project manager get?

A live-in construction project manager's salary typically ranges from $70,000 to $120,000 annually, depending on experience, location, and project size. They often receive additional benefits such as housing allowances or accommodations, and must coordinate schedules and oversee daily operations on-site.

Is there a demand for live in construction project managers?

Construction project managers, including live-in roles in remote or specialized projects, are in steady demand due to ongoing infrastructure development and renovation needs. These roles often require strong leadership, scheduling, and familiarity with construction management software, with demand influenced by economic growth and construction industry trends.

Where do live in construction project managers make the most money?

Live-in construction project managers tend to earn higher salaries in regions with high construction activity and cost of living, such as major metropolitan areas or regions experiencing rapid development. Factors like experience, certifications, and the complexity of projects also influence earning potential, with those managing large or complex projects typically earning more.

Job Summary

Moore Industries seeks a Design-Build Construction Project Manager to lead projects from design through closeout. You'll manage design firms, coordinate subcontractors/vendors, control budgets and schedules, and oversee construction execution for industrial and commercial projects.

Key Responsibilities
  • Project Turnover & Planning:Receive turnover from estimating, validate scope, establish execution plans, cost codes, communication paths, and baseline schedules
  • Budget & Controls:Build and publish baseline budgets, set up cost tracking and forecasting, establish change management processes, create monthly reporting tools
  • Design Management:Manage external design firms, lead design meetings and gate reviews (SD/DD/Permit/IFC), maintain client interface, drive constructability reviews, coordinate subcontractor input, manage RFI strategy
  • Subcontract Buyout:Develop and execute buyout plans, scope and award subcontracts/POs, negotiate terms to meet budget and schedule, ensure proper insurance and safety requirements
  • Procurement & Materials:Manage long-lead procurement logs, coordinate material releases and logistics, track vendor drawings/submittals, align procurement with construction schedule
  • Construction Mobilization:Finalize project schedules, coordinate preconstruction conference, site logistics, safety planning, confirm manpower and temporary facilities, set up project systems
  • Construction Management:Support day-to-day execution, manage schedules and RFI/submittal logs, oversee cost forecasting and change management, lead coordination meetings, enforce QA/QC compliance
  • Closeout:Drive punchlist completion, manage closeout deliverables (as-builts, O&M manuals, warranties), ensure subcontract closeouts, complete final cost reconciliation
Required Qualifications
  • Bachelor's degree in Construction Management, Civil Engineering, Architecture, or equivalent experience
  • 5+ years managing industrial/commercial construction projects; design-build experience preferred
  • Proficiency with Primavera P6, Bluebeam, PlanGrid, and Microsoft Excel
  • Strong budgeting, scheduling, cost forecasting, and contract management skills
  • Working knowledge of building codes and safety regulations
